Tales from the Crypt was a horror anthology series that aired for seven seasons from 1989 to 1996. The show was known for its unique blend of horror, humor, and suspense, and it quickly became a cult favorite. The series featured a number of high-profile actors, with stars like Arnold Schwarzenegger, Brad Pitt, Whoopi Goldberg, Michael J. Fox, and Demi Moore all appearing in episodes. Tales from the Crypt was such a hit that it broke out of its R-rated confines to become a Saturday morning cartoon and a children’s game show. Despite its popularity, the classic show is not available on HBO Max due to licensing issues. Fans have been eagerly waiting for the show to return to its original home, but for now, it remains unavailable.

The Reasons Behind HBO Max Removing Shows.
HBO Max, the popular streaming service, is facing a significant change as Warner Bros. Discovery has decided to license 13 of its HBO/HBO Max originals to third-party free ad-supported streaming (FAST) services. This move has raised concerns among the HBO Max subscribers who may lose access to some of their favourite shows. However, the good news is that the shows won’t be disappearing forever. The shows will now be available on other platforms, which are supported by ads. This strategic move is being taken by Warner Bros. Discovery to expand the reach of its content and make it more accessible to a larger audience. As a result, HBO Max subscribers will have to look for alternatives to watch their favourite shows, which may not be available on the platform anymore. This change is a part of the growing trend in the industry towards licensing content to multiple platforms to increase revenue and audience reach.

Exploring the HBO Controversy: Which Shows Were Removed?
HBO Max, like any other streaming platform, updates its content library frequently, and this often means that some shows have to be removed to make room for new ones. In recent times, several original TV shows have been removed from HBO Max, much to the disappointment of their fans. Among those shows are “12 Dates of Christmas,” a reality dating series that follows singles as they search for love over the holidays. Another show that was removed is “About Last Night,” a stand-up comedy series that featured comedians discussing their worst dating experiences.
Also, “Aquaman: King of Atlantis,” an animated series based on the DC Comics character, was pulled from the platform. “Close Enough,” an adult animated sitcom that follows a young couple as they navigate parenthood and adult life, was also removed from the platform. “Ellen’s Next Great Designer,” a reality competition series that sees contestants compete to win a cash prize and a contract with Ellen DeGeneres’ home décor brand, was another show that didn’t make the cut.
Moreover, “Esme & Roy,” a children’s animated series that follows a young girl and her monster best friend as they solve problems for their fellow monsters, was taken down. “FBOY Island,” a reality dating series that aired earlier in the year, in which women try to distinguish between “nice guys” and “FBOYS” (f-boys), was also removed. Additionally, “Finding Magic Mike,” a reality show that sees a group of men compete to join the cast of the “Magic Mike Live” show in Las Vegas, was taken off the platform.
